Default Max power out of Vortech V-2,3 Si trim

Who's got the record?

Mine did 747rwhp 652tq on a mustang with 66% E85 at 9psi. Ls3 with a N/A cam.

Rpm limit of blower is what matters, not boost. 9 psi can easily be way over spinning it.
